The Jonas Brothers released the lyric video for their new Christmas song “I Need You Christmas” on Monday (November 16).
The brother trio’s new visual features a lot of home videos from holidays in their childhood, as well as some from more current years.
“Put together a little something from our old photos and home movies for the #INeedYouChristmas lyric video. Hope you like it 🎄🎠Watch the full thing now on YouTube!” they wrote on Instagram.
“The #INeedYouChristmas lyric video is here and I gotta say… Might I recommend re-watching old home movies while listening to Christmas songs 🎅ðŸ¼ðŸŽ„ðŸŽ,” Joe added on his own account.
Nicksaid, “So many incredible memories in this! Hope you guys love the #INeedYouChristmas lyric video as much as we do!”
“Happy Holidays! Hope you guys like the new #INeedYouChristmas lyric video. Watch now on YouTube 🎄,” Kevinadded.
“Emotional to watch, especially this year. Are you missing someone this Christmas? @jonasbrothers I NEED YOU CHRISTMAS,” the boys’ dad Kevin Jonas Sr wrote on his Twitter.
The Jonas Brothers previously said that the song “stirs up memories of childhood snowball fights and finding the nearest hill to sled. It brings us back to spending time with family setting up the Christmas tree. Hopefully it can bring you guys the same feelings of warmth and happiness that creating it has brought us.”

Nick Jonas is opening up about his brother Joe‘s newborn daughter Willa!
The 28-year-old entertainer remained fairly mum about the newest addition to the Jonas family, but did admit she’s pretty great.
“I have [met her],†Nick told ET. “It’s, you know, Joe and Sophie’s thing to speak about or not, but she’s the best.â€
“I wish we could all be together, but that’s so many families’ wish and dream at the moment,†he added about the upcoming holidays. “But yeah, I’m grateful everyone’s healthy and happy. We’ve all been very fortunate, but looking forward to a time when life gets back to hopefully some kind of version of normal and we can spend more time together.â€

The Jonas Brothers are giving us a new song for the holiday season!
“I Need You Christmas” is a new holiday ballad released by the brothers and it’s a direct contrast to their Christmas song from last year, “Like It’s Christmas.” The new single was announced just hours before it was released.
The brothers said in a joint statement, “With having such a crazy year, we all really need something to look forward to. The Holidays is a time that brings us together and is something that brings us joy in the darkest of times. For us, this song stirs up memories of childhood snowball fights and finding the nearest hill to sled. It brings us back to spending time with family setting up the Christmas tree. Hopefully it can bring you guys the same feelings of warmth and happiness that creating it has brought us. We love you guys very much!â€
